HP Pavilion x360 13-u004tu

Hello Everyone !! 

 

I own HP Pavilion x360 13-u004tu, I am facing performance issue that's why looking to add an SSD and upgrade RAM. Can someone advise if my laptop support adding SSD in addition to existing HDD. If, YES, what type of SSD. 

 

Also what is the maximum RAM I can upgrade to. At the moment the laptop has 4GB RAM.

Hi:

 

Below is the link to the service manual for your notebook.

 

HP Pavilion x360 m3 (model numbers m3-u100 through m3-u199, m13-u100 through m13-u199, m3-u000 throu...

 

Chapter 1 has the memory upgrade info.

 

If you look at chapter 3 of the manual different motherboards are used for the models that come with M.2 SSD's and 2.5" hard drives.

 

Since your notebook has a 2.5" hard drive, in order to upgrade to a SSD, you would need to replace the 2.5" hard drive with a 2.5" SSD.

 

Below is the link to the Crucial memory site.

 

They have compatible memory for sale.

 

HP - Compaq Pavilion x360 13-u004tu | Memory RAM & SSD Upgrades | Crucial IN

 

I would suggest that you buy the 2666 MHz memory because it costs much less than the 2400 MHz memory and should work just fine.

 

This is the 8 GB equivalent part number for the 4 GB DDR4-2666 MHz memory chip listed in the above memory report:

 

Amazon.in: Buy Crucial RAM 8GB DDR4 2666 MHz CL19 Laptop Memory CT8G4SFRA266 Online at Low Prices in...
